See the attached photo.

Ran this through the front tire on my 4wd M7040 while mowing CRP ground today. Had no choice but to pull it out and watch the tire go flat. Of course I was a good distance from the barn and road. I had to roll the tire up and down a hill to get it to my truck. It was heavier than I thought.

I had heard of this happening to others but this was my first.

I guess the deer are getting back at me for shooting them in my younger days.

The tire has a tube. They patched the tire and the tube. They charged me $23.75. Seemed like a good deal.

I was back up and mowing this afternoon.
